The University of Arkansas at Little Rock is seeking an Adjunct Faculty to teach computer science-related courses at the undergraduate level. This position will be responsible for, but not limited to, the following job duties: teaching course(s), providing mentoring support for students, assessing student-submitted work products, managing teaching assistants, and following course objectives and syllabus prepared for the courses.
